Don’t be fooled by the websites that promise to bring traffic to your website for a costly fee. Gaining website traffic doesn’t have to be expensive. It may take a little time and effort, but there are many ways to increase your traffic for free.

Knowing your target audience is a good place to start. It is important to learn what people are searching for so that your web contents will match their needs. Research what key words or phrases are being searched and be liberal in using these in the headings and articles on your site. Be sure to keep your website up to date. Always strive to provide current information that is useful to your readers.

Make good use of other websites by adding reprint directories that include links to your site. This will put you in a good position for other website owners to select your articles as they review these reprint articles in an effort to find information for their own sites. When they choose your articles they will be automatically linking their readers to your site which is a sure way to increase your website’s traffic.

Making good use of blogs is also important. Be sure to provide links to intriguing information that you provide on your site. Use your blog to inform readers when you have updated information or added new articles that may be of interest to them. This will help your readers to get to know your site and will encourage them to visit repeatedly. Don’t forget to include your link to make visiting your site as easy as one click.

Networking is another tool that is a free way to increase traffic to your site. Using forums or message boards is a great way to advertise your site and reach new customers. Some browsers may view your message and recommend your site to others. When you post information make good use of the signature line for advertising. As always, it is important to provide a direct link to your site.

Having a newsletter or ezine that you send to your mailing list on a weekly or monthly basis will also help you increase traffic. You can include information on any updates you have made to your site as well as links to articles and other pages your readers will find helpful.

Advertising for others will also draw viewers to you. Tell your viewers about a new e-book or e-course, or inform them of a special report that will provide them with useful information. If by way of your website they find information that is helpful to them they will develop a trust for your recommendations and will turn to your site again for direction.

If you have an informational or tangible product for sale, you may want to consider establishing an affiliate program. The more affiliates that you have promoting your product, the more traffic that will come to your site.
